Output ade6dd3aef9fcf989103c667283091e86a0d0d5aa7de9fa998b749bb5574d2d6:1

value
618200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7265d4fa57e316337ccd64ce385215f50efa9b01 OP_EQUAL
address
3C7twpWiifUzAFPhFTwcbm69qKE95pAL33
transaction
ade6dd3aef9fcf989103c667283091e86a0d0d5aa7de9fa998b749bb5574d2d6
confirmations
422026
spent
true